SENATOR DR PATRICK IFEANYI UBAH'S RE-ELECTION PROJECT GETS A MAJOR BOOST.

...as a group known as Door-2-Door 4 Sen Ifeanyi Ubah commences operation One member, Ten voters for Sen Ifeanyi Ubah.

The re-election project of the Senator representatimg Anambra South, who is also the Young Progressives Party (YPP) Candidate for Anambra South Senatorial District in the Feb. 25th National Assembly Election, got a major boost Monday, 30/01/2023 as a group known as the Door-2-Door 4 Sen Ifeanyi Ubah, after it's enlarged executive meeting, resolved to commence a rigorous grassroot campaign tagged " OPERATION ONE MEMBER, TEN VOTERS" in support of the Senatorial ambition of Sen. Dr. Patrick ifeanyi Ubah.

In his opening speech, the leader/convener of the group, Hon Bona Ogbonna, reminded the members of how important it is that Sen Dr Patrick Ifeanyi Ubah (Ebubechukwu Uzo) is returned as the Senator representatimg Anambra South Senatorial District for the second term.

According to Hon Bona, the decision was precipitated by the leadership and representative antecedents of Sen. Ubah; ranging from Economics, Commerce, Education, Healthcare, Environment, Sports, Human Capital Development and Infrastructures.
Continuing, Hon Bona reminded the members of the group, that the Senator has been a forerunner of quality and vibrant representation as evident from the motley of bills and motions he has sponsored and moved at Senate within the last three years.

Speaking further, Hon Bona, enumarated some of these bills which includes; Petroleum Tankers Safety Bill, Bill for National Institute for Business Studies Nnewi, Power and Petroleum Safety Bill Oraifite Erosion Control and Prevention Commission Bill, Bill for Institute of Rice Research and Development Amichi, Matallurgy Training Institute Bill Orumba, Bill for Establishment of Center for Sickle Cell Anaemia Research and Treatment in Aguata, Bill for the establishment of Federal Orthopedic hospital in Ukpor, Nnewi South just to mention but a few. He equally reminded them of the already existing robust synergy between the Senator and the Governor of Anambra State through the Senator's Operation Light up and Secure Anambra South Senatorial District, which have become a laudable and a pace setting feet for other Legislators both at the State and the Nation at Large.

He made it clear that the only way to Consolidate on these unprecedented achievement of Sen Ubah, is to make sure that he is re-elected, so that the good work will continue. He, therefore urged members of the group to go from Door to Door, House to House, Store to Store, Office to Office and galvanize, canvass and mobilize the much needed support for the return of Sen. Dr Patrick Ifeanyi Ubah of the Young Progressives Party (YPP) to the Senate come February, 25th 2023.

The group's woman leader, Lady Amaka Okonkwo, in her speech, appreciated the members for turning out in large number, more especially those that came with various gift items which according to her, is a very good sign that members of the group truly, we love Sen Ubah.
Continuing, Lady Amaka reminded the women about the 21 houses the Senator built and furnished for randomly selected widows across the Seven Local Govt Areas in Anambra South, she urged the women to go all out and prove to the Senator that they are the real owners of the Grassroot. She prayed that God will continue to guide and protect Sen Ifeanyi Ubah as he journeys round the Senatorial District.

Speaker after speaker, eulogized Sen Ubah for changing the narrative of Senatorial representation in Anambra South, and the country in general with his superlative performances within the last three years, and despite his being a first time Senator which led to his being decorated with the title of "The Prince of the Senate" by the Senate President and other 108 Senators of the 9th Senate.

The highlights of the meeting which was a huge success, was the presentation and distribution of various gift items which includes, tubers of yam, biscuits, assorted drinks and kola donated by the group members as a show of their true love for the Senator.

The meeting ended with Prayers for God's divine guidance, protection and blessings upon Sen Dr Patrick Ifeanyi Ubah, his household and members of his campaign council.
